Re: Official leaked Froyo 2.2 FRF84B

I installed this from my rooted 2.1 and so far everything seems pretty good. I didn't bother with clearing cache and everything seems to be running quick. I used SETcpu to overclock. It may be a placebo effect, but I feel like battery life is better. One thing though, Storm8 games like Imobster are NOT compatible. Major graphical issues.
